The elements that have a more powerful affinity for that stationary period will elute afterwards, causing their separation in the a lot less polar parts.

The interactions While using the stationary period may also affected by steric effects, or exclusion outcomes, whereby a component of pretty significant molecule could have only restricted access to the pores of the stationary section, where by the interactions with area ligands (alkyl chains) occur. These surface hindrance typically ends in a lot less retention.

The migration amount may be described since the velocity at which the species moves through the column. And the migration price (UR) is inversely proportional for the retention instances.

Gas chromatography (GC) and substantial-functionality liquid chromatography (HPLC) are both equally extensively used analytical tactics in chemistry. The primary distinction between The 2 lies inside the cell stage useful for separation. In GC, the mobile period is a gasoline, typically helium or nitrogen, even though in HPLC, It's really a liquid solvent. This distinction influences the kinds of compounds that may be analyzed by Just about every method. GC is much more well suited for volatile and semi-unstable compounds, as they may be vaporized and carried through the column through the fuel.
